2013 Metro Club of the Year:
Dartmouth Club of Greater Boston

Henry Ford once said "Coming together is a beginning; keeping together is progress; working together is success." The Dartmouth Club of Greater Boston is the epitome of this statement.

As the oldest and largest alumni club in the world, Boston has plenty of past experience to strengthen its efforts while at the same time the sheer size and diversity of its constituency, results in an interesting set of challenges. The officers of the club, led by President Chip Conner `85, work tirelessly with each other and teams of volunteers to offer a wide variety of social events ranging from an evening with the Boston Pops to Red Sox games, Aires concerts, film screenings and the Head of the Charles Regatta, just to list a few of their offerings in 2013. On the civic side, they organized 18 different community service events attracting over 90 alumni and 30 guests.

The club also invests a great deal of time and energy to future and current Dartmouth students. Thanks to the tremendous groundwork laid by Reverend Donald Fitzsimmons `46, Boston has the most comprehensive Book Awards Program in the world, bestowing 125 copies of "The Poems of Robert Frost" to deserving high school juniors in their area each year. No other club comes even close to that number. In addition, Boston has one of the largest alumni interviewing programs; 940 interviews of potential members of the Class of 2017 were completed by 373 alumni interviewers. The 131 accepted students were also personally visited by an alumni club volunteer who presented them with a Dartmouth t-shirt. Once the students are on campus, the club continues their support through a robust scholarship program.
